Mr. Andrew Lawrence O'Neal of 16 Earl Court, Columbus, Georgia died Friday, April 16, 2021 at the Piedmont Midtown Hospital in Columbus, Georgia.

The  graveside funeral service to be attended by the immediate family ONLY will be held Saturday,  May 1, 2021 at 2:00 PM at the Sunnyside Cemetery in Cordele,  Georgia.  Everyone in attendance is asked to please wear a mask and to practice social distancing.

On December 23, 1962, Mr. George Edward O'Neal, Sr. and Mrs. Jennie Mae Barnes welcomed a son to this world. Born in Dublin, Georgia, they named their blessing, Andrew Lawrence O'Neal.

Andrew was educated in the public school system.  He attended Charles R. Drew, Pine Villa, Mays Junior High School and Southridge Senior High.  He went on to attend Miami-Dade Community College in Miami, Florida.  Andrew also became a Certified Carpenter during his studies at Jacob's Creek Job Corp in Bristol, Tennessee.

Realizing a desire to have a closer walk with the Lord, he united with the Mount Pleasant Baptist Church in Miami, Florida.

Andrew was good at so many things.  He busied himself as a sanitation worker, maintenance man, caregiver and cyclist.  He also enjoyed landscaping and carpentry.
